But which little television is going to do the best job for you?

Very popular is the Envizen 7-Inch Handheld Digital TV, which is priced at a mere $139.99 MSRP (you can buy it on sale for even less) and also comes with a built in DVD player. Take it on family vacations and keep the kids quiet in the back of the car for hours. You can listen with or without earphones, and either plug it in or run it on batteries for a maximum time of about 1-1/2 hours.

A lot of people who buy the Envizen also consider the Haier HLT71 7-Inch Handheld LCD TV, available frequently for about $110, which is a discount of the manufacturer's list price of $129.99. 

Axion AXN-8701 and Tivax HiRez7 are also in the same price range and offer similar features. Before you sign on the dotted line, make sure they come with an antenna, or else you are might end up having to pay extra to be able to get the reception as promised.

If you are going to want to receive all the channels in your area, I would not simply buy one of these portable TVs sight unseen off the internet. First I would visit some big box retailers and get live demonstrations. There is no point in saving $10 of one model or another if that means you will only receive half the stations being broadcast. After checking out the different makes and models and comparing prices, then if a better deal is to be had on the internet, you can make a more informed decision.
